HERE ARE THE STOCK AND MEASURES FOR THIS CARD:

CARDSTOCK:

Whisper White Thick- base, 8.5″ x 5.5″ scored @ 4.25″ fold in half on the score

Whisper White Regular- oval

DSP:

Brightly Gleaming Specialty DSP- 3″ x 4″

STAMP SET:

Perfectly Plaid- greeting and inside sentiment, pinecones

INK:

Soft Suede- pinecones, greeting and inside sentiment

TOOLS:

Big Shot- die cutting machine

Stitched Shapes Dies- oval

ACCESSORIES:

Cherry Cobbler Sheer Linen Ribbon- bow and flagged piece

Clear Wink of Stella- brushed on front and inside pinecones
